Tips for Enhancing Educational Value Through Phacochoerus Africanus Illustrations

Optimizing illustrations of Phacochoerus africanus for coloring amplifies their educational potential. Strategic application of design principles and factual accuracy can significantly improve the learning experience.

Tip 1: Emphasize Anatomical Accuracy: Ensure the illustration accurately reflects the anatomical features of Phacochoerus africanus. Prominent tusks, a distinct mane, and characteristic facial warts should be clearly depicted. Reference photographic sources to ensure fidelity.

Tip 2: Illustrate Habitat Context: Integrate elements of the animal’s natural environment into the design. Include background details such as grasslands, watering holes, or acacia trees to provide context and aid in understanding its ecological role.

Tip 3: Employ a Clear Outline Style: Utilize bold, well-defined outlines to facilitate ease of coloring, especially for younger users. This enhances the visual clarity of the subject and prevents color bleeding.

Tip 4: Offer Varied Poses and Perspectives: Present Phacochoerus africanus in multiple poses, such as standing, running, or wallowing. Varying the perspective adds visual interest and allows for a more comprehensive understanding of the animal’s form.

Tip 5: Incorporate Educational Labels: Add labels identifying key anatomical features, such as “tusk,” “mane,” or “wart.” This reinforces vocabulary and enhances the learning experience.

Tip 6: Choose a Realistic Color Palette: Suggest a color palette that accurately represents the natural coloration of Phacochoerus africanus. Typical color ranges include grey, brown, and tan hues. This promotes accurate visual representation and reinforces learning.

Tip 7: Include Line Variations: Use varying line weights to create visual depth and emphasis. Thicker lines can be used for outlines, while thinner lines can represent details within the animal’s form. This enhances the overall aesthetic appeal and reinforces visual hierarchy.

By adhering to these guidelines, illustrations become more than just a coloring activity; they evolve into valuable educational resources. They foster an appreciation for wildlife and promote learning in an engaging and accessible manner.
